Simplify square root of 72
LuckyWell [14K]
(square root of  72)  =  square root of (36  times  2)

That's the same as  (square root of  36)  times  (square root of  2).

But the square root of  36  is  6 .

So the square root of  72  is    (6)  times  (square root of  2) .
